Center for Advanced Materials and Manufacturing Innovation

The Center for Advanced Materials and Manufacturing Innovation (CAMMI) is an entryway into the University of New Hampshire for companies to share their challenges and explore collaboration opportunities. The center's goal is to make CAMMI a trusted and efficient partner for small- and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), as well as large national and international corporations.

CENTER FOR CYBERSECURITY LEADERSHIP, EDUCATION, AND OUTREACH

The Center for Cybersecurity Leadership, Education, and Outreach (CCLEO) is a designated Center of Academic Excellence in Cyber Defense Education by the U.S. National Security Agency and the Department of Homeland Security. CCLEO offers educational programs in cybersecurity as well as external outreach and support to businesses and governments in New Hampshire and beyond.

John Olson Advanced Manufacturing Center

The John Olson Advanced Manufacturing Center (The Olson Center) is focused on advanced manufacturing technologies and a cross-curricular approach to engineering and manufacturing concepts. The center is designed to help bridge the skills gap in the nation’s $1.7 trillion manufacturing industry, and serve as a home for academically derived technology incubators, with particular focus on high ­precision machining, light materials, flexible electronics and ‘Industry 4.0’.

UNH Center for Infrastructure Resilience to Climate

The UNH Center for Infrastructure Resilience to Climate (UCIRC) is dedicated to accelerating and advancing the development of new methods and approaches to planning, design, and operation and maintenance of climate and weather resilient transportation and building infrastructure systems. UCIRC is also working to develop and implement effective public policy solutions concerning these pressing issues.

Center for Ocean Renewable Energy (CORE)

The Center for Ocean Renewable Energy (CORE) provides multiple-scale research, technology development and evaluation, education, and outreach related to Ocean Renewable Energy systems.
